聖老楞佐堂 Igreja de S. Lourenço
St. Lawrence's Church is a historic Catholic church in Macau, one of the territory's oldest religious structures. The local name is 聖老楞佐教堂. It stands as a significant monument within the Historic Centre of Macau, a UNESCO World Heritage Site. The church exemplifies the Portuguese colonial architectural heritage that defines much of Macau's distinctive cultural landscape. Its elevated position offers views toward the Inner Harbour area. The building represents the enduring Catholic tradition established during Portuguese administration, reflecting the religious and cultural synthesis that characterizes Macau's unique identity as a former trading port.

The interior of St. Lawrence's Church follows traditional Catholic church arrangements with a nave, altars, and religious statuary typical of Portuguese colonial ecclesiastical design. Decorative elements include woodwork and ornamental features consistent with Baroque-influenced church architecture found in Macau. The main altar and side chapels contain religious imagery and devotional objects. The spatial configuration reflects European liturgical planning adapted to local construction methods and materials available during the colonial period.
